Hi This has nothing to do with Costa Esuri... but just a bit of hard earned experience.. that has something to do with the PC's we need to get onto the forum.

I bought a new PC a few months ago and this week decided to upgrade the Vista to Vista Ultimate and the old M-S Office to M-S Office Ultimate.

It went really well, and I was pleasantly surprised at how easy the process was and how it all worked seamlessly and easily.....

All was going well .....

Then I had a problem, all because I named my user account Jon's Acount. The apostrophe and maybe the space meant that none of the Office Help would work properly. Now when you have a new product you need the help a lot, and so I got caught.

Well its now several hours later, including calls to the M-S call centre in India and them taking over my PC remotely ...... and creating a new user account and moving all the stuff to the new account .... and redoing everything etc etc its still not over. I have at the moment to move all my email files to the new user....... what a DRAG!!!:curse:

It worked fine with the Vista home edition.... but its probably the new Office that has the problem

So if you buy a new Vista PC, whatever version you have that may work now, dont create any user accounts with spaces, punctuation... in fact just use letters. If I'd called my account 'Jon' with no punctuation I would be delighted with M-soft.

Im sure that for years to come I will find things that dont work, because there are links to the old user account. And I suspect that I will be switching accounts rather that just using those pieces of software.

All because of an apostrophe!!! One little character caused hours or work... and maybe for ages to come more problems. I now have 2 user accounts on my PC for me as well.....
